Class ConversationsHistoryRequest
java.lang.Object
com.slack.api.methods.request.conversations.ConversationsHistoryRequest
- All Implemented Interfaces:
SlackApiRequest
https://docs.slack.dev/reference/methods/conversations.history
-
Nested Class Summary
Nested ClassesModifier and TypeClassDescriptionstatic class -
Method Summary
Modifier and TypeMethodDescriptionbuilder()protected booleanbooleanConversation ID to fetch history for.Paginate through collections of data by setting the `cursor` parameter to a `next_cursor` attribute returned by a previous request's `response_metadata`.End of time range of messages to include in results.getLimit()The maximum number of items to return.Start of time range of messages to include in results.getToken()Authentication token.inthashCode()booleanReturn all metadata associated with this message.booleanInclude messages with latest or oldest timestamp in results only when either timestamp is specified.voidsetChannel(String channel) Conversation ID to fetch history for.voidPaginate through collections of data by setting the `cursor` parameter to a `next_cursor` attribute returned by a previous request's `response_metadata`.voidsetIncludeAllMetadata(boolean includeAllMetadata) Return all metadata associated with this message.voidsetInclusive(boolean inclusive) Include messages with latest or oldest timestamp in results only when either timestamp is specified.voidEnd of time range of messages to include in results.voidThe maximum number of items to return.voidStart of time range of messages to include in results.voidAuthentication token.toString()
-
Method Details
-
builder
-
getToken
Authentication token. Requires scope: `conversations:history`- Specified by:
getTokenin interfaceSlackApiRequest- Returns:
- token string value or null
-
getChannel
Conversation ID to fetch history for. -
getCursor
Paginate through collections of data by setting the `cursor` parameter to a `next_cursor` attribute returned by a previous request's `response_metadata`.Default value fetches the first \"page\" of the collection. See [pagination](/docs/pagination) for more detail.
-
getOldest
Start of time range of messages to include in results. -
getLatest
End of time range of messages to include in results. -
getLimit
The maximum number of items to return. Fewer than the requested number of items may be returned, even if the end of the users list hasn't been reached. -
isInclusive
public boolean isInclusive()Include messages with latest or oldest timestamp in results only when either timestamp is specified. -
isIncludeAllMetadata
public boolean isIncludeAllMetadata()Return all metadata associated with this message. -
setToken
Authentication token. Requires scope: `conversations:history`- Specified by:
setTokenin interfaceSlackApiRequest
-
setChannel
Conversation ID to fetch history for. -
setCursor
Paginate through collections of data by setting the `cursor` parameter to a `next_cursor` attribute returned by a previous request's `response_metadata`.Default value fetches the first \"page\" of the collection. See [pagination](/docs/pagination) for more detail.
-
setOldest
Start of time range of messages to include in results. -
setLatest
End of time range of messages to include in results. -
setLimit
The maximum number of items to return. Fewer than the requested number of items may be returned, even if the end of the users list hasn't been reached. -
setInclusive
public void setInclusive(boolean inclusive) Include messages with latest or oldest timestamp in results only when either timestamp is specified. -
setIncludeAllMetadata
public void setIncludeAllMetadata(boolean includeAllMetadata) Return all metadata associated with this message. -
equals
-
canEqual
-
hashCode
public int hashCode() -
toString
-